| Bullet train in India - running at speed 300-350 km per hour |
 |
Soon India will also have bullet train running at speed 300-350 km per hour, On first phase it will have two interconnected railway tracks
Delhi-Chandigarh-Amritsar” and
Pune-Mumbai-Ahmedabad”
High-speed train running at 300-350 kmph may be launched before 2015. High-tech energy efficient and environment friendly systems in the project would be used to ensure high efficiency. The current target would be only “rich passengers” who are ready to buy tickets in comparison to with airline fares. The construction work for the project would take at least five years to complete. |

| Bandra - Worli Sea Bridge, India's first sea-link bridge (More on pipeline...) |
 |
The Bandra Worli Sea Link will be an 8-lane and its a cable-stayed bridge, which will link Bandra and Worli and central Mumbai, and is the first phase of the proposed West Island Freeway system. The total project cost is expected near around Rs. 1600 crore by Maharashtra State Road Development Corporation (MSRDC) is being executed by Hindustan Construction Company.
Mumbai's second sealink has been planned between worli and Haji Ali. It is a 4.5 km stretch and will cost Rs 750 crore. It will be a six-lane carriageway. The other two sealinks will be Haji Ali to Bhulabhai Desai Road and from Bhulabhai Desai Road to Nariman Point. |

| Tehri Dam - 5th tallest dam in the world |
 |
| Tehri Dam - 5th tallest dam in the world is the primary dam of the Tehri Development Project, a major hydroelectric project situated near Tehri Town in the state of Uttarakhand in India. Located on the Bhagirathi River, the Tehri Dam has a height of 855 feet (261 m).. The dam has a power generation capacity of 2400 MW, irrigation to an area of 270,000 hectares, irrigation stabilization to an area of 600,000 hectares, and a supply of 270 million gallons of drinking water per day to the areas of Delhi, Uttar Pradesh and Uttarakhand. |
